Managing warfarin requires consistent vitamin K intake-not restriction. Learn how steady eating keeps your INR in range, reduces bleeding and clot risks, and improves long-term safety without avoiding healthy foods.

Learn how high-potassium foods interact with common blood pressure medications like ACE inhibitors and spironolactone. Understand the risks of hyperkalemia and how to eat safely without giving up healthy foods.

In my recent exploration, I came across how Restless Leg Syndrome (RLS) significantly impacts sleep quality. RLS is a condition characterized by an irresistible urge to move the legs, which can lead to sleep deprivation. This interruption in sleep often leads to daytime fatigue, impacting overall well-being and productivity. It's not just about discomfort, but also the increased risk of developing mental health conditions. It's quite clear, managing RLS is essential not just for a good night's sleep but for maintaining overall health.
Authorized generics are identical to brand-name drugs but sold without the brand label. They offer cost savings with the same ingredients and quality, but aren't always the cheapest option. Learn how they work and when to ask for them.
